Our Monthly Rhythm: Habits, Poems, and Book Club

Each month in Restoration Home Community centers on a theme and includes:

  • Simple habit practices for daily life
  • Poetry and beautiful words to read and memorize together
  • A book club selection, discussed during our monthly virtual gathering

This gentle rhythm supports healthy homeschool habits, Charlotte Mason–inspired learning, and faith-centered family culture without burnout or overwhelm.

January: Restoration

Habits

  • Time log
  • Daily vision review
  • Eye contact

Poems

  • Apostles’ Creed

Sonnet 116: “Let me not to the marriage of true minds” by William Shakespeare

  • Stopping by Woods on a Snowy Evening by Robert Frost
  • God Speaks to Each of Us by Rainer Maria Rilke

Book Club

  • The Legacy Life by David Green and Bill High

February: Habits of Work

Habits

  • 7-minute workout
  • Chore chart training
  • 15-minute read-aloud

Poems

  • How Doth the Little Busy Bee by Isaac Watts
  • She Walks in Beauty by Lord Byron
  • Little Things by Julia Abigail Fletcher Carney
  • The Pasture by Robert Frost

Book Club

  • Man of the Family by Ralph Moody

March: Habits of Stewardship

Habits

  • Morning routine before screens
  • Teach room care
  • 30 minutes outside

Poems

  • I Have Found Such Joy by Grace Noll Crowell
  • Crossing the Bar by Alfred Lord Tennyson
  • The Frog by Hilaire Belloc
  • The Common Tasks by Grace Noll Crowell
  • The Lord’s Prayer

Book Club

  • Tending the Heart of Virtue by Vigen Guroian
